Nothing clear

The Improvised Explosive Devices (IEDs) that struck the gathering in front of the city's Hossaini Dalan early hours Friday have been used in the country by militant outfits in the past. Operatives of banned Jama'atul Mujahideen Bangladesh (JMB) and Harkat-ul Jihad (Huji) have the expertise to make them and the materials are also available in the country. But any third party, like Islami Chhatra Shibir, might acquire this know-how, investigators said.
